The MPH program at Ohio University seeks to improve the well-being of rural and other underserved populations by preparing public health professionals who will passionately pursue bold public health solutions based upon the highest standards of public health knowledge, skills, and scientific proficiency. Unique to the program is enhanced coursework and experiential activities focused on the needs of rural communities in Appalachia and on underserved communities domestically and internationally. With both online and on-campus programs, students are exposed to a diverse network of professionals throughout the country who are working in wide-ranging organizations from government, corporations, health departments, community-based organizations and healthcare settings.
